Gyandeep Bihar RTE School Admission 2024-25 PDF: The Education Department of the Bihar Government has established the GYANDEEP portal to facilitate the enrollment of boys from disadvantaged groups in non-profit private schools approved under the Right to Education Act 2009. This initiative, in accordance with Section 12(1)(c) of the Act and Rule 11 of the Free and Compulsory Education Rules, 2011, aims to provide reimbursement of funds to schools for enrolling boys from vulnerable communities.

Bihar RTE School Admission: Enrollment Figures 2018-2023
State-wise and year-wise statistics on the status of children admitted/studying under Section 12 (1) (c) of the Right to Education (RTE) Act of 2009 over the past five years in Bihar are as follows: In the academic year 2018-2019, there were a total of 225,597 enrollments, which increased to 276,792 in 2019-2020. Subsequently, in 2020-2021, the number rose to 295,807, and in 2021-2022, it further climbed to 345,667. The most recent data for 2022-2023 shows a total of 367,453 enrollments, reflecting a positive trend in the educational inclusion of children from marginalized backgrounds.
Bihar RTE School Admission: Reimbursement Status
Section 12(2) of the Right of Children to Free and Compulsory Education (RTE) Act outlines the process for reimbursing Private Unaided Schools for admitting children under Section 12(1)(c). This reimbursement is based on the per-child expenditure notified by the State or the actual amount charged by the school, whichever is less. The reimbursement supports the expenditure incurred for 25% admissions in private unaided schools under Section 12(1)(c) of the RTE Act, and has been facilitated under Samagra Shiksha since 2014-15 (formerly under SSA).

Bihar RTE Admission Gyandeep Online Portal 2024-25
The GYANDEEP portal serves as a platform for the registration of schools under the RTE, scrutiny of school-wise entries at the district level, approval of reimbursement amounts, and facilitation of all related operations such as payments. Starting from the academic session of 2024-25, parents can also nominate their children for enrollment in approved private schools under Section 12(1)(c) through this portal. Selection criteria will be based on the submitted applications, following guidelines outlined in Office Number 505 dated June 15, 2023.
To access the GYANDEEP portal, individuals can visit the URL pmsonline.bih.nic.in/rte. The portal offers various functionalities for easy access, including announcements regarding Aadhaar information. The Directorate of Primary Education, Government of Bihar, assures that Aadhaar information will solely be utilized to secure benefits under the RTE Act 2009, Section 12(1)(c).
